On October 18, 1587, the galleon Nuestra Señora de Buena Esperanza landed by Morro Bay. Here, Filipinos—then referred to as indios luzones—made contact with the Chumash people. This moment became the first recorded presence of Asians in the continental United States, predating the Saint Malo settlement in Louisiana by nearly two centuries. For centuries, this landing went unrecognized until the Filipino American National Historical Society (FANHS), founded by Dorothy and Fred Cordova in 1992, worked to recover and honor it. Through their efforts, Morro Bay was officially dedicated in 1995. Each October, Filipino American History Month continues to commemorate this pivotal moment. For many, the landing at Morro Bay represents the intertwined story of Filipinos in the United States—a reminder that while this was the beginning of our recorded history here, community efforts ensure our stories continue to live on.
